在計算機網絡中,主機名是指一個能夠唯一標識服務器或客戶端的名稱。MySQL是一種流行的關系型數據庫管理系統,它使用主機名來確定連接到特定服務器的客戶端。在本文中,我們將探討如何設置和更改MySQL主機名。
# 查詢當前主機名 SELECT @@hostname; # 更改主機名 SET GLOBAL hostname='new_hostname';
要查詢當前主機名,我們使用MySQL的@@hostname系統變量。如果您發現主機名不正確,可以使用SET GLOBAL命令來更改它。注意,更改主機名可能會影響與MySQL建立的所有連接。
在設置主機名之前,請確保您有足夠的權限。這可以通過以下命令來檢查:
SHOW GRANTS FOR 'username'@'hostname';
在這個命令中,我們使用SHOW GRANTS for命令來獲取給定用戶在特定主機上的授權。如果需要更改主機名的權限,則您可能需要聯系管理員來獲得此權限。
總之,主機名是MySQL連接過程中的一個關鍵因素。通過熟悉MySQL的主機名設置流程,您可以更好地管理和維護您的數據庫系統。